Finding GCD of 625, 320, 102, 207 using Prime Factorization

Given Input Data is 625, 320, 102, 207

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 625 is 5 x 5 x 5 x 5

Prime Factorization of 320 is 2 x 2 x 2 x 2 x 2 x 2 x 5

Prime Factorization of 102 is 2 x 3 x 17

Prime Factorization of 207 is 3 x 3 x 23

The above numbers do not have any common prime factor. So GCD is 1

Finding GCD of 625, 320, 102, 207 using LCM Formula

Step1:

Let's calculate the GCD of first two numbers

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(625, 320) = 40000

GCD(625, 320) = ( 625 x 320 ) / 40000

GCD(625, 320) = 200000 / 40000

GCD(625, 320) = 5


Step2:

Here we consider the GCD from the above i.e. 5 as first number and the next as 102

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(5, 102) = 510

GCD(5, 102) = ( 5 x 102 ) / 510

GCD(5, 102) = 510 / 510

GCD(5, 102) = 1


Step3:

Here we consider the GCD from the above i.e. 1 as first number and the next as 207

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(1, 207) = 207

GCD(1, 207) = ( 1 x 207 ) / 207

GCD(1, 207) = 207 / 207

GCD(1, 207) = 1

GCD of 625, 320, 102, 207 is 1
